Pre-deployment training is just the beginning! Employees will receive additional training on arrival in theatre and at regular intervals throughout their deployment. Qualified DND and SNC-Lavalin PAE personnel will provide the instruction.
On arrival ...
All CANCAP personnel will attend Arrival Assistance Group (AAG) briefings that will be conducted by Canadian Forces personnel. In addition, they will receive facilities orientation briefings with a key focus on security. Briefings include but are not limited to:
Description of the camp and any satellite locations
Personal quarters (accommodations, ablutions, dining and recreational facilities)
Camp restrictions on movements and out of bounds areas
Safety areas where personal protective equipment is essential
Purpose of Help Desk/CANCAP Operations Centre/Response Centres and their locations
Emergency drills and assembly areas

Refresher Training is conducted on some aspects of the content that was delivered during PDT. Refresher Training will be conducted once every 6 months so that you will receive it at least once during your contract.
Refresher Training ensures that our employees skills and knowledge in essential aspects of camp life are kept up to date and that you are comfortable responding to an emergency situation.
